matlab inca dat
时间: 2023-11-04 14:03:30 浏览: 232
MATLAB是一种用于科学计算和数据分析的高级编程语言和环境,而INCA是一种用于汽车领域的测试和测量软件。两者可以结合使用来进行汽车性能的分析和优化。
MATLAB在汽车领域具有广泛的应用。它可以用于设计和仿真车辆控制系统、开发车辆动力学模型、进行数据处理和可视化等。通过使用MATLAB,工程师们可以轻松地进行车辆动力学和操纵性的研究,改进车辆性能和经济性。
而INCA软件则是一种用于汽车测试和量测的工具。它可以与车辆的ECU(电子控制单元)进行通信,并记录和分析各种传感器数据和ECU参数。INCA提供了实时数据采集功能,能够帮助测试工程师监测和分析车辆在实际驾驶中的性能、燃油消耗、排放等。
结合MATLAB和INCA可以进一步拓展汽车研发和测试的能力。通过连接这两个软件,可以实时地将INCA采集的数据传输到MATLAB中进行进一步的算法处理和数据分析。这样,工程师们可以更加深入地了解和优化车辆的性能,并提出改进控制算法和系统参数的建议。
综上所述,MATLAB和INCA都可以在汽车领域发挥重要作用。MATLAB提供了强大的数值计算和可视化功能,而INCA则提供了车辆实时测试和数据记录的能力。结合使用这两个工具,可以帮助工程师们更好地研究和改进汽车性能。
相关问题
matlab-inca api
MATLAB-INCA API是指MATLAB与INCA软件之间的接口。INCA是由ETAS开发的汽车诊断软件,用于对汽车电子控制单元(ECU)进行诊断、参数设置和数据记录等操作。
MATLAB-INCA API提供了一个桥梁,使得MATLAB用户可以通过MATLAB编程语言使用INCA软件的功能。通过该接口,用户可以在MATLAB中对汽车ECU进行诊断和参数设置,还可以利用MATLAB强大的数据分析和处理能力对INCA记录的数据进行更深入的分析。
使用MATLAB-INCA API,用户可以通过MATLAB编写脚本实现对汽车ECU的访问和控制。例如,可以通过API命令获取ECU的诊断结果,对参数进行设置,并且可以在MATLAB中实时监控ECU的状态变化。
MATLAB-INCA API还提供了数据交换的功能,用户可以在MATLAB和INCA之间进行数据的传输和转换。用户可以将INCA记录的数据导入到MATLAB中进行分析,也可以将MATLAB中的数据导出到INCA进行进一步的测试和验证。
总之,MATLAB-INCA API大大拓展了MATLAB的功能,使得用户可以更方便地使用MATLAB进行汽车ECU的诊断和数据分析。通过该接口,用户可以更高效地开展汽车电子控制相关的研究和开发工作。
matlab读取分析inca数据
Matlab是一种广泛用于数学计算、数据分析和工程应用的高级编程语言,对于INCA(Interactive Network Configuration Assistant)数据的读取和分析,INCA通常生成的是文本格式的数据文件(如CSV或TXT)。你可以使用Matlab内置的数据读取函数来处理这类数据。
以下是基本步骤:
1. **加载数据**:首先,你需要使用`readtable`或者`csvread`函数来导入CSV或TXT文件。例如:
```matlab
data = readtable('your_file.csv'); % 如果是CSV文件
or
data = textscan('your_file.txt', '%s%f%f'); % 如果是简单文本格式,每行包含几个数值
```
2. **预处理数据**:检查并根据需要清洗数据,比如删除空值、转换数据类型等。可以使用`ismissing`、`isnan`以及`str2double`等函数。
3. **数据分析**:对数据进行统计分析、可视化或者其他所需的计算操作。Matlab提供了一系列强大的工具箱,如Statistics and Machine Learning Toolbox,用于各种数据分析任务。
4. **绘制图表**:利用`plot`、`scatter`或`histogram`等函数创建图形,展示数据特征。
5. **保存结果**:完成分析后,可能还需要将结果保存到新的文件或数据库中,可以用`writetable`或`csvwrite`等函数。
阅读全文